With so many virtual reality (VR) headset makers investing in controllers and room-scale tracking, you would think gamers are taking to their feet, moving around to get the full breadth of the VR experience. Surprisingly, that’s not exactly the case. According to Jason Rubin, VP of content at Oculus, many Oculus Rift owners prefer to play sitting down. Speaking at E3 2018 last week, Rubin said many gamers are actually requesting a “seated play” mode for Oculus Rift games. “When we started working in VR, we assumed everybody would be standing, everybody would be doing those things,” Rubin said, as reported by Upload VR. “It turns out a lot of people – perfectly healthy people – would like at the end of a hard day of work, or whatever they’re doing, to just sit down. But they appreciate the immersion of VR and everything else.”
